The Men's 2021-2022 FIH Hockey Pro League will reach its conclusion this year. The competition is contested between nine top teams and the tournament will showcase the best talent on the hockey fields. It also serves as the qualifier for the Hockey World Cup and Olympic Games. In this edition, the tournament started on 16th October 2021 and will reach it's climax on 30th June 2022.
The format of this competition is based on the home and away principle. However, this principle was split over two consecutive seasons from 2020-2021 season onwards. This works according to the following example. Team A will host team B within a couple of days and vice-versa. The tournament underwent a lot of changes with the participants.
New Zealand, Australia and Canada have withdrawn from the tournament. South Africa and France came in as their replacements. This year the tournament will resume from the 4th of Feb. The last game of the tournament was played in November 2021, between the Netherlands and Belgium.
India will look to clinch their first ever Pro League title, having already won the bronze medal at the Tokyo Olympics. They begin their tournament against France on February 8th in South Africa.
